Understanding game math RTP volatility variance hit frequency and payout distribution
RTP stands for return to player and represents the long run average of how much a casino game returns to players as a percentage of wagered money over many spins or plays. In the context of non gamstop betting companies the RTP of slots, table games, and card games is a property of the game rules rather than a guarantee of individual results. Beyond RTP, volatility or variance describes how often outcomes occur and how large the wins or losses can be. High volatility games pay less frequently but provide larger wins; low volatility games pay more often with smaller wins. Hit frequency is a practical measure of how often a spin or hand produces a win, and payout distribution shows how winnings are spread across sessions. Players should separate theoretical RTP from real experience, recognizing short term results can deviate from expected values. Bonus mechanics and wagering rules on non gamstop sites
Bonuses on non gamstop betting companies may include welcome offers, reloads, or free bets. The mechanics behind these offers can involve wagering requirements, game weighting, maximum bets during promotion, expiry dates, and withdrawal restrictions. Wagering requirements specify how many times a bonus amount must be staked before a withdrawal is possible, and this can vary widely by operator and jurisdiction. Game weighting means different games contribute differently to the wagering total; some games may contribute 100 percent, while others contribute less or not at all. Maximum bet rules constrain how much you can stake while the bonus is active, reducing the risk of aggressive play. Expiry dates determine how long you have to meet the wagering conditions, and withdrawal restrictions may limit the amount you can cash out from winnings generated with bonus funds.
